PT TOMORROW: AL Central—Sale’s injury creates opportunity

Chicago White Sox

Chris Sale (LHP, CHW) will be unable to make his Opening Day start, but should miss only 2-3 starts, due of an avulsion fracture in his right foot. Sale’s injury opens the door for several pitchers vying to make the White Sox roster. Carlos Rodón (LHP, CHW) will be the immediate beneficiary, as he will make a start during the first week of spring training games. If Rodon pitches well as a starter this spring, he will likely make the team with Sale out. Rodon was profiled in this column last week.
